Output f3000d157ecd49e6f6c2835468807843b78b5fb81ae118b9d4bf2cadaca2cd5c:32

value
160326
script pubkey
OP_0 OP_PUSHBYTES_32 7e4e7c593c85cb17e5c3446dbb91f5ba9a8c545ef66d9e38e4d92a904188040e
address
bc1q0e88ckfush930ewrg3kmhy04h2dgc4z77ekeuw8ymy4fqsvgqs8qx87za5
transaction
f3000d157ecd49e6f6c2835468807843b78b5fb81ae118b9d4bf2cadaca2cd5c
confirmations
53044
spent
true